Copart has opened a new location in Buffalo, New York, marking the sixth location for the company in the state, the company announced.

The Buffalo facility will host bi-weekly auctions on Mondays at 9 a.m. central time beginning on July 29, 2019.

Buyers will be able to place bids online through Copart's VB3 auction technology, through Copart's mobile app, or through bidding kiosks found onsite.

Copart primarily deals with online sales and offers services to process and sell salvage and clean title vehicles to dealers, dismantlers, rebuilders, and exporters.

Copart sells vehicles on behalf of insurance companies, banks, finance companies, charities, fleet operators, dealers, and individual owners.

Copart has more than 125,000 vehicles available online every day, according to the company.
